2. Exchange rates to the South African rand
Year-end rates
US dollar 6.8355 7.0010
British pound 13.6074 13.7297
Euro 9.9935 9.2189
Average rates for the year
US dollar 7.0506 6.7706
British pound 14.1126 12.4805
  Euro   9.6651 8.5065
3. Cash operating costs
Cash operating costs consist of the following principal categories:
    On-mine*
Rm
Smelting
Rm
Treatment
and refining
Rm
2007
Labour 6,396 286 382
Stores 4,527 351 325
Utilities 825 293 76
Contracting 2,709 9
Sundry 1,668 375 161
Toll refining 103
    16,125 1,314 1,047
2006
Labour 5,062 269 325
Stores 3,545 363 303
Utilities 758 317 67
Contracting 2,269 17 4
Sundry 1,349 272 112
Toll refining 104
    12,983 1,238 915
*On-mine costs comprise mining and concentrating costs
